Output fcfaefaf21bbc2f8788979dfe360e52e4c3843d32ac2fd9cba8bb760f0fabb78:181

value
3933932
script pubkey
OP_0 OP_PUSHBYTES_20 6b385e1bfd6ea15ab53f37b0bd93616605fdd658
address
bc1qdvu9uxlad6s44dflx7ctmympvczlm4jcpek468
transaction
fcfaefaf21bbc2f8788979dfe360e52e4c3843d32ac2fd9cba8bb760f0fabb78
confirmations
121149
spent
true